js返回的设置方法

2025-01-09 15:41:22   小编

js返回的设置方法

在JavaScript编程中,返回值是函数的一个重要特性,它允许函数将计算结果或数据传递给调用者。正确设置返回值的方法对于编写高效、灵活的代码至关重要。下面将介绍一些常见的js返回的设置方法。

最基本的返回方法是使用return关键字。在函数内部,当执行到return语句时,函数将立即停止执行,并返回指定的值。例如:

function add(a, b) {
  return a + b;
}
let result = add(3, 5);
console.log(result); 

在这个例子中,add函数接受两个参数ab,并返回它们的和。

如果函数没有显式地使用return语句,或者return后面没有跟任何值,那么函数将返回undefined。例如:

function sayHello() {
  console.log('Hello!');
}
let greeting = sayHello();
console.log(greeting); 

这里sayHello函数没有返回值,所以greeting的值为undefined

除了返回简单的数据类型,函数还可以返回对象、数组等复杂的数据结构。例如:

function createPerson(name, age) {
  return {
    name: name,
    age: age
  };
}
let person = createPerson('John', 30);
console.log(person.name); 

这个函数返回一个包含nameage属性的对象。

另外,函数还可以返回另一个函数。这种技术被称为闭包,它可以用于创建私有变量和实现模块化。例如:

function counter() {
  let count = 0;
  return function() {
    count++;
    return count;
  };
}
let increment = counter();
console.log(increment()); 
console.log(increment()); 

在这个例子中,counter函数返回一个内部函数,该内部函数可以访问并修改counter函数中的局部变量count

掌握js返回的设置方法对于编写高质量的JavaScript代码至关重要。通过合理地使用返回值,可以使代码更加模块化、可维护和可扩展。在实际开发中,根据具体需求选择合适的返回值类型和设置方法,能够提高代码的效率和可读性。

TAGS: 设置技巧 js方法 js返回值 返回设置

欢迎使用万千站长工具!

Welcome to www.zzTool.com